FAQ

What age groups does Fit First, Irvine serve?

We work with children from toddlers through teenagers, including our “Junior Programs” (for younger kids focused on motor skills and coordination) up to older youth engaged in strength, conditioning, and sport-specific classes

Do I need to register online, and how do I sign up?

Yes, you can register for classes, camps or private training 100 % online. Simply use the “Book Now” or “Register” button on our site to choose your service and pay securely.

What happens if my child has an injury, medical condition or special needs?

No problem, our head coach is both a certified trainer and experienced in special education and is prepared to adapt sessions. Please let us know about any injuries, allergies or medical issues ahead of time so we can provide appropriate modifications.

What kinds of programs are offered at the Irvine location?

At Irvine we offer a variety of programs including Junior Programs, Summer Camps, One-on-One Training, Special Needs Training, Group Classes (Strength & Conditioning, Yoga, Ninja/Parkour, etc.), and Team Sports sessions.

We don’t see a physical facility listed, do you train outdoors or at a fixed gym?

At the moment, we utilize park and community sites (for example: Colonel Bill Barber Marine Corps Memorial Park, David Sills Lower Peters Canyon Park, Harvard Community Park) in Irvine for our sessions.
